Jared Anderson addresses viral ‘stress’ second with Roy Jones Jr.: ‘Everyone is banking on me’

Jared Anderson is a 24-year-old boxing sensation extensively thought-about to be the subsequent nice longing for American heavyweight boxing.

A two-time nationwide champion as an novice, Anderson carries with him the good weight of expectation, and final yr, it regarded like he could be crumbling underneath these expectations when “The Actual Huge Child” had a viral second with boxing Corridor of Famer Roy Jones Jr., the place he broke into tears whereas speaking in regards to the stress he’s going through.

Talking with The MMA Hour, Anderson addressed the second, talking candidly in regards to the outside-the-ring pressures he faces as he continues to ascend the heavyweight ranks.

“It was roughly about life itself,” Anderson stated. “Individuals all the time attempt to make issues about simply boxing as a result of I’m a boxer, however that’s not my life. Sure, I’ve accomplished this virtually my whole life. I’ve been doing this since I used to be eight years outdated. However boxing will not be my life. Day-after-day I stroll out of that gymnasium, I’ve obtained to go house and face my issues. I’ve obtained to go house and face what’s occurring. I’ve obtained to go house and face the issues that I’ve in all places else. That’s extra of the stress I used to be saying.

“At the moment, I used to be 23 and I’ve a mom who’s in her 60s, a father who’s in his 60s, a sibling who’s in jail, has been incarcerated for 10-plus years now. I’ve obtained eight or 9 different siblings who aren’t doing financially the very best. On high of that, I’m introducing a daughter into this world now. … I’ve obtained a lot occurring in my life, that’s the stress I’m feeling. Everyone is banking on me.

“I obtained a name from my brother, most likely a number of months earlier than then, my brother was making an attempt to determine, ‘How are you going to assist me get out due to your place?’ That hit a nerve for me, as a result of I perceive I’m in an important place however I’ve by no means accomplished something unlawful. I’ve been boxing my whole life and I began this as a child, so I’ve nonetheless obtained a child mindset. Me not understanding get by sure challenges in life to assist the folks that I actually, actually wish to assistance is a number of stress.”

Anderson is scheduled to defend his WBC-USNBC and WBO Worldwide heavyweight titles towards Martin Bakole on August 3 in Los Angeles.

Whereas Anderson seems to have a really brilliant future in boxing, he’s nonetheless a far cry from the kind of life-changing paydays the most important stars earn. And that truth, coupled with the mounting stress of expectations, led to Anderson’s teary second.

“I wish to assist my mother financially, despite the fact that I’ve by no means had one million {dollars},” Anderson continued.

“Having one million {dollars} to assist my mother so she doesn’t ever must work once more, is a stress. Wanting to speak to sure legal professionals to assist my brother get a judicial launch is a stress. Coping with issues with my father, as a result of the individual I name my father will not be my organic father, so coping with problems with not having my organic father there and taking over my brother’s dad as my father, these are pressures. Making an attempt to make folks pleased with my household, these are pressures that individuals simply don’t perceive.

“It was extra of a stress from simply making an attempt to make the folks round me proud and in addition nonetheless having fun with life and never having the ability to do what I wish to do, however must do with a view to do this. That’s an enormous quantity of stress on such a younger child whereas on the similar time being referred to as round America, ‘The Subsequent Nice American Heavyweight.’ That’s stuff that individuals simply don’t perceive as a result of they don’t perceive that I’m a human too, and all of it type of boiled over in that one second.”

However simply because he’s feeling stress, doesn’t imply Anderson isn’t prepared.

“The Actual Huge Child” welcomes the title of “The Subsequent Nice American Heavyweight” and believes he’s able to ship on that promise.

“100%,” Anderson stated when requested if he’s OK with being referred to as the longer term face of American heavyweight boxing. “I’m OK with it, just because it’s doing nothing however selling me extra. So the extra folks say it, the higher for me. I’ve to understand that. Do I look after it? I actually don’t. However that’s a private factor for me, in a legacy manner. That’s a private factor I don’t look after. In the event you say it otherwise you don’t, it’s your opinion. Nevertheless it helps promote me and make me look higher, so in fact I’ve to take it in, I’ve to understand it, and know that it’s coming from an excellent place.”

“And the rationale I agree with it’s my caliber of preventing,” Anderson added. “I do know what I’m able to, I do know who I’ve been in there with, and I do know what I’ve accomplished behind closed doorways.”

In the intervening time although, Anderson continues to be on the surface wanting in in terms of the highest ranks of the heavyweight division. However the 24-year-old believes that might change within the close to future given his work with promoter High Rank and his assist from Turki Al-Alshikh, Chairman of the Saudi Arabia Normal Leisure Authority.

“Nicely, with Turki taking part in an element, perhaps a battle or two?” Anderson stated. “Sooner somewhat than later. With him being concerned, him having the boldness in me and eager to push me … I might see it being one other yr or two earlier than something [big] opens up, however by that point, having Turki or High Rank, I do imagine that I may very well be in place.”
